Double-Fish-Handled Jar with Phoenix and Scrolling Peony Motifs


Era: Yuan Dynasty
Name: Double-Fish-Handled Jar with Phoenix and Scrolling Peony Motifs
Dimensions: Height: 36.4 cm, Mouth Diameter: 14.7 cm, Base Diameter: 16.3 cm

Characteristics:
• The jar features a small mouth and a flared rim.
• The shoulder and neck are adorned with double fish handles, positioned parallel to intricate phoenix motifs entwined with scrolling lotus patterns.
• Below the phoenix design, there are additional decorative elements, including miscellaneous treasure motifs.
• The same layer features inscriptions attributed to the “Strategies of Guiguzi.”
• The primary design theme of the jar is scrolling peony motifs.
• The jar has a plain base, wide foot, gracefully rounded shoulders, and a globular body that tapers below.
• The entire piece is painted using imported cobalt blue pigment (“Sumaliqing”).

Blue and White "Cloud and Bat" Bell-shaped Zun

Period: Qing Dynasty
Name: Blue and White "Cloud and Bat" Pattern Yaoling Zun
Dimensions:
- Height: 24.9 cm
- Mouth Diameter: 5.1 cm
- Foot Diameter: 15 cm

Features:
This Yaoling Zun, steeped in historical significance, boasts a unique form. It features a small rounded lip, a long neck, a full shoulder, a cylindrical body, and a base coated in white glaze. The vessel is inscribed with a six-character regular script mark in underglaze blue: "Da Qing Kangxi Nian Zhi" (Made during the Kangxi Reign of the Great Qing). The body is fully adorned with lingzhi (sacred fungus) cloud patterns and bat motifs.
